要删除HBase中的表空间,可以使用HBase shell或HBase管理REST API来执行删除操作。以下是使用HBase shell删除表空间的步骤:
- 打开HBase shell:
hbase shell
- 列出所有的表空间:
list_namespace
- 删除指定的表空间(例如,名为"example"的表空间):
delete_namespace 'example'
请注意,删除表空间将删除该表空间中的所有表和数据。在执行删除操作之前,请确保您已备份并移除需要保留的数据。
要删除HBase中的表空间,可以使用HBase shell或HBase管理REST API来执行删除操作。以下是使用HBase shell删除表空间的步骤:
hbase shell
list_namespace
delete_namespace 'example'
请注意,删除表空间将删除该表空间中的所有表和数据。在执行删除操作之前,请确保您已备份并移除需要保留的数据。
数据写入失败:HBase是基于HDFS的分布式存储系统,当数据写入HBase时可能因为网络故障、服务器故障或其他原因导致数据写入失败,从而导致数据不一致。 数据更新错...
HBase数据倾斜问题处理方法如下: 数据预分区:在创建HBase表时,可以根据业务需求将数据预先分为多个Region,避免数据倾斜。可以使用哈希值、时间范围等作为分区...
数据分布不均匀:数据分布不均匀会导致部分Region存储的数据量过大,从而造成数据倾斜。 大量小文件:如果数据量很大,但是数据被分散存放在大量小文件中,就会导...
在HBase中查询表数据条数可以使用Java API或者HBase Shell来实现。以下是两种方法:
方法一:使用Java API
import org.apache.hadoop.conf.Configurat...
要清空HBase表中的所有数据,可以使用HBase shell或者HBase Java API中的truncateTable方法。
使用HBase shell清空表中所有数据的步骤如下: 打开HBase she...
HBase备份数据到本地的方法有多种,其中一种比较简单的方法是通过使用HBase自带的工具进行备份,具体步骤如下: 在HBase的主节点上运行以下命令查看表的数据: h...
在HBase中进行批量查询数据时,可以通过以下几种方式来优化性能: 批量读取数据:使用HBase的批量操作API(如Scan)来读取多行数据,减少每次请求的开销,提高读...
如果在HBase中导入了数据后无法查询,可能是由于以下几个原因导致的: 表的schema定义不正确:确保表的schema(列族和列限定符)与实际导入的数据一致。如果sche...